Winter Challenges on Nepal’s 8,000m Peaks Demand Unmatched Endurance and Skill
Scaling Nepal’s towering 8,000-meter giants during winter presents an array of formidable obstacles that push even the most seasoned climbers to their limits. Extreme cold, hurricane-force winds, and relentless snowfall turn these ascents into grueling battles against nature. Besides the technical difficulties posed by treacherous ice formations and unstable seracs, climbers must also contend with severely reduced oxygen levels, challenging their physical and mental endurance. Success on these summits is reserved for those who combine meticulous preparation with exceptional skill in high-altitude mountaineering.
Key factors that differentiate successful winter expeditions from failed attempts include:
- Advanced acclimatization protocols to mitigate altitude sickness
- Mastery of ice climbing and rope techniques in adverse weather
- Risk management strategies to navigate avalanches and crevasse zones
- Robust expedition logistics ensuring timely resupplies and shelter establishment

Success Stories Reveal Key Strategies for Surviving Extreme High-Altitude Conditions
Among the handful who have successfully summited Nepal’s towering 8,000-meter peaks during the harsh winter months, a pattern of resilience and meticulous preparation emerges. Physical conditioning alone is insufficient; climbers report that adaptability to rapidly changing weather, mental fortitude, and strategic acclimatization plans are equally critical. Survivors consistently emphasize the importance of lightweight gear optimized for extreme cold and the ability to make swift decisions under pressure, often the difference between life and death on icy ridges and crevasse-laden slopes.
Key strategies shared by these elite mountaineers include:
- Gradual Acclimatization through staged camps to reduce altitude sickness risk
- Weather Window Optimization by consistently monitoring forecasts and adjusting summit pushes accordingly
- Efficient Team Coordination resulting in faster route fixing and enhanced safety
- Minimalist Load Management to conserve energy and improve mobility
- Backup Oxygen Plans to navigate unexpected respiratory challenges

Expert Recommendations for Future Winter Expeditions in the Himalayas
Seasoned climbers emphasize that meticulous preparation tailored to the unique challenges of winter Himalayan ascents is non-negotiable. Experts advise focusing on acclimatization strategies that accommodate extreme cold and unpredictable weather, while advocating for the integration of cutting-edge gear designed specifically for subzero conditions. Furthermore, the importance of assembling experienced teams cannot be overstated-team members must bring not only physical endurance but also proven skills in high-altitude navigation and emergency response.
- Prioritize weather window forecasting: Utilize advanced meteorological data to plan summit pushes.
- Invest in high-tech insulation: Materials that reduce weight without compromising warmth.
- Implement staged acclimatization: Multiple intermediate camps to optimize adaptation.
- Develop contingency protocols: Clear evacuation and communication plans in case of sudden storms.
